Having a fairing sure helps on long rides.
I had this fairing on for a number of years:



It was handle bar mounted. Some handle bar mounted fairings will throw your steering around a bit when a large truck/bus passes you in the opposite direction.
I took it off one Winter and left it off to start the season. After a few long rides I put it right back on. My neck was getting too sore without it.
